How Do I Find the Linksys WRK54G v1.1 Login IP Address?
The default IP address for the Linksys WRK54G v1.1 is commonly
192.168.1.1. If you are unsure about the IP address or if it has been changed, you can often find it by checking your computer's network settings. On Windows, you can open the Command Prompt and type
ipconfig. Look for the "Default Gateway" listed for your active network connection. On macOS or Linux, open the Terminal and type
ip route | grep default or
netstat -nr | grep default. The IP address listed as the default gateway is your router's IP address. The source text also indicates that the IP address might be found on a sticker on the back of the router itself.
How Do I Reset the Linksys WRK54G v1.1 Router Password Without Logging In?
You can reset the Linksys WRK54G v1.1 to factory defaults without knowing the current password by using the hardware reset button.
- Locate the Reset Button: Find the small, usually black, reset button on the back or bottom of the Linksys WRK54G v1.1 router. It might be recessed and require a paperclip or pin to press.
- Press and Hold: With the router powered on, press and hold the reset button for approximately 10 seconds.
- Release the Button: Release the button. The router will restart and return to its factory default settings.
- Reconnect and Log In: After the router has fully rebooted, you will need to reconnect to its default Wi-Fi network (if applicable) and use the default IP address, username, and password (usually
192.168.1.1, admin, and admin respectively) to log in.
A hard reset will erase all custom settings, including your Wi-Fi network name (SSID), password, and any other configurations you may have made. This is a common method for a "reset router password without login" scenario.
Why Can't I Log In to My Linksys WRK54G v1.1 Router?
If you are unable to log in to your Linksys WRK54G v1.1 router, the most common causes include using the incorrect IP address, entering wrong credentials, or browser-related issues.
*
Incorrect IP Address: Ensure you are using the correct IP address for your router. While
192.168.1.1 is the default, it may have been changed, or your network might be configured with a different IP range. Verify the IP address using the
ipconfig command on Windows or
ip route on macOS/Linux.
*
Incorrect Credentials: Double-check that you are entering the correct username and password. If the password was changed from the default
admin, you will need to use the new password or perform a factory reset.
*
Browser Cache: Sometimes, a browser's cache can interfere with accessing web interfaces. Try clearing your browser's cache and cookies, or use a different web browser or an incognito/private browsing window.
*
Connection Issues: Ensure your device is properly connected to the router's network, either via Ethernet cable or Wi-Fi. A faulty cable or a weak Wi-Fi signal can also cause login problems.
How Do I Secure My Linksys WRK54G v1.1 Router After Login?
To enhance the security of your Linksys WRK54G v1.1 router and network, follow these essential steps after successfully logging into the admin panel:
- Change the Default Password: The most critical step is to change the default router password from
admin to a strong, unique password. This prevents unauthorized access using common default login for router credentials. Aim for a password that is at least 12 characters long, combining u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ols. - Secure Your Wi-Fi Network: Change the default Wi-Fi network name (SSID) and set a strong password using WPA2 or WPA3 encryption if supported. WPA3 offers superior security to WPA2.
- Update Firmware: Check for and install any available firmware updates for your Linksys WRK54G v1.1. Firmware updates often include security patches that protect against known vulnerabilities.
- Disable Remote Management: Unless you specifically need to access your router's settings from outside your home network, disable the remote management feature. This significantly reduces the attack surface.
- Enable Firewall: Ensure the router's built-in firewall is enabled and configured appropriately to protect your network from external threats.
- Guest Network: If your router supports it, set up a separate guest network for visitors. This keeps your main network secure and isolates guest devices.
